Fresh Start Banner

     
Position   Crew Members (7)
     
Location(s)  •  Rusk County
     
Qualifications   •  You must be able to perform vigorous daily work with a minimum of accommodation.
     
Benefits  •  Fresh Start provides young men & women between the ages of 18-24, with education, employment skills, career direction, paid work & service experience which leads to self-sufficiency.
   •  Members spend part of their day at a work site constructing a single-family home which is sold to a lower-income family.
   •  Members also spend part of their time in the classroom working towards successful completion of a GED/HSED.
   •  All members receive basic skills assessment, individual tutoring for GED/HSED, job readiness & retention training, career and financial planning.
   •  A noon meal is provided and members get a "fresh start" towards successful adulthood & prospective employment opportunities.
